"Assistant Manager"
Description
- Contribute to comprehensive reviews of tenders and projects exceeding SGD 25 million, identifying areas for improvement in cost reporting and forecasting.
- Collaborate with project teams to ensure accurate financial projections and enhance standardization in cost reporting practices across all projects.
- Develop tailored procurement strategies during the tender/pre-contract phase of major projects, reviewing project specifications and contract conditions.
- Verify cost competitiveness at the tender submission stage, highlighting contractual or specification risks and offering recommendations to senior management.
- Evaluate projected profit margins to confirm alignment with the project's risk profile.
- Perform audits on projects as requested by senior management, evaluating report accuracy, financial and legal/contractual risks, and QS and contract administration team performance.
- Audit key contract administration functions such as SOP compliance, procurement schedules, document registers, and subcontractor management.
- Provide support on commercial and legal matters, including Extension of Time (EOT) requests and cost claims.
- Collaborate with Financial Planning & Performance, Corporate Planning, Legal, and Governance teams as required.
- Coordinate and attend tender submission review meetings with group companies, ensuring effective risk management, advising on risk controls, and documenting meeting minutes.
- Attend project cost control meetings with group companies to evaluate cost management practices and provide guidance for improvement.
- Participate in cost feedback sessions to analyze profit or loss causes and assist in developing preventive measures and cost control improvements for future projects.
- Organize and coordinate meetings related to project profit and loss (P&L) reviews, including feedback and analysis sessions.
- Monitor and assess cost control operations and P&L management across group companies, recommending improvements where necessary.
- Support root cause analysis of profit fluctuations and help formulate and disseminate preventive or profit-enhancing measures across group entities.
- Become proficient in the new cost control system and assist in training relevant staff across group companies.
- Facilitate communication between group companies and headquarters regarding updates on current tenders and ongoing project statuses.

Senior Observability Platform Specialist
As a Senior Observability Platform Specialist, you will play a crucial role in advancing our company's observability platform. Your primary responsibility will be to leverage your extensive experience in various observability platform implementations to keep our product at the forefront of the industry. You will act as a bridge between the technical and business realms, ensuring that our platform not only meets current market standards but also sets new benchmarks for innovation and functionality.
Responsibilities
- Market Analysis and Competitive Research: Conduct in-depth research to stay abreast of the latest trends and advancements in observability platforms. Perform detailed comparisons of competing products to identify strengths, weaknesses, and market gaps. Regularly present findings to the team, highlighting potential areas for innovation and improvement in our product.
- Requirement Gathering and Analysis: Work closely with the product management team to translate market research into concrete business and functional requirements. Organize and lead brainstorming sessions to generate new ideas and approaches for product enhancement. Develop clear, detailed documentation of required features and functionalities.
- Collaboration and Strategy Formulation: Collaborate with senior management to align product development strategies with company objectives. Actively participate in strategic planning sessions, offering insights from a market and technical perspective.
- Product Development and Enhancement: Lead the initiative to fill gaps in our current product offerings based on market research and competitive analysis. Guide the technical team in the design and development of new features and functionalities. Ensure that product enhancements are executed within the set timelines and meet quality standards.
- Stakeholder Engagement and Communication: Maintain constant communication with the product manager and other stakeholders to align on priorities and delivery schedules. Present regular updates to senior management on progress, challenges, and milestones.
- Team Leadership and Mentorship: Provide mentorship and guidance to team members working on observability platform projects. Foster a culture of innovation and continuous improvement within the team.
Required Skills
- Significant expertise with observability software such as SolarWinds, ManageEngine, Zabbix, Site24x7, or similar platforms.
- Demonstrated experience in design and deployment of at least 10 client implementations of such observability software.
- Proven ability to implement, set up, and enhance medium to large systems using these tools, whether building from scratch or transitioning from one platform to another.
- Comprehensive understanding of Cloud technologies (AWS, Azure, GCP), Networking principles and enterprise IT infrastructure.
- Strong understanding of market trends, customer needs, and competitive landscape in the observability tools and monitoring solutions space.
- Ability to define and prioritize product features based on customer feedback, data analysis, and industry best practices.
- Experience working with cross-functional teams including engineering, design, marketing, and sales to drive product development and go-to-market strategies.
- Proficiency in creating product roadmaps, user stories, and specifications for development teams.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to make data-driven decisions and iterate on product features based on feedback and metrics.
- Strong leadership and communication skills to effectively communicate product vision, goals, and updates to stakeholders and teams.
- Experience in driving product adoption, user engagement, and customer success initiatives.
- A passion for technology and a keen interest in staying updated with the latest advancements in observability, monitoring, and cloud technologies.
Educational Qualification
Bachelors degree in Business Administration, Information Technology, or a related field.

Founded in 1999 and listed on NASDAQ in 2003 and HKEX in 2021, Trip.com Group is a leading global travel service provider comprising of Trip.com, Ctrip, Skyscanner, and Qunar.
Across its platforms, Trip.com Group integrates travel resources from industry partners and helps travellers worldwide pursue the perfect trip with exceptional travel products and services.
We have four Customer Service Centres for Trip.com established in Japan, Korea, the UK, and the Philippines, providing 24/7 customer service in 19 different languages.
We have more than 30,000 employees scattered across 30 countries in Asia, Europe, the Americas, and Oceania, striving to expand our global markets and aiming to be the world’s leading and most trusted family of online travel brands that aspire to deliver the perfect trip at the best price for every traveller.
